En 2020, les Éditions Maison des Langues s’engagent aux côtés de Reforest’Action pour la restauration de l’environnement et la protection de la biodiversité en plantant 2 000 arbres en France et à l’étranger. Cette collaboration s’ajoute à de nombreuses autres décisions prises par les Éditions Maison des Langues pour agir concrètement sur la réduction de l’impact de leur activité (utilisation de papier certifié FSC, suppression des enveloppes en film plastique, goodies en matières recyclées et recyclables...) et sensibiliser leurs publics notamment dans les ouvrages qu’elles publient.

Les Éditions Maison des Langues proposent une large gamme d’ouvrages et de ressources numériques de qualité pour l’enseignement des langues en France et à l’étranger. Largement reconnues pour leur implication dans le monde de l’éducation, elles œuvrent depuis plus de 10 ans avec la volonté de proposer une vision innovante et ouverte sur le monde à tous les apprenants. Fortement impliquées dans la recherche en didactique et attachées à fournir des outils qui facilitent le quotidien des enseignants, elles organisent également des ateliers de formation.
